§ 38-4-6 — Subpoena of Witnesses

The state department and the county department shall have the power to issue subpoenas for witnesses and compel their attendance and the production of papers and writings and duly authorized employees of said departments may administer oaths and examine witnesses under oath.

Legislative History

(Acts 1951, No. 703, p. 1211, §18.)
